Comparing All Options
Bank Loan
$55K, 5 years, 9%
Monthly:
$1,140
Planned Mortgage
$40K max, 25 years, 4.5%
Monthly:
$266
Home Equity
$55K+, 20 years, 4%
Monthly:
$333
Save $807/month with home equity vs bank loan!
Which Option to Choose?
Small renovation (under $27K): Bank loan - simple and fast.
Have existing mortgage, need $40K: Planned renovation mortgage.
Large renovation ($55K+): Home equity loan - cheapest option.

It depends on renovation type: Cosmetic renovation (painting, flooring, electrical) - $27K-$55K. Medium renovation (kitchen, bathrooms, windows) - $70K-$110K. Comprehensive renovation (including load-bearing walls, infrastructure) - $140K-$220K. Luxury renovation (architectural design, imported materials) - $275K+.
